被告 ひこく hikoku

JMdict entry #1484410

  1. noun (common) (futsuumeishi) law defendant; the accused
    see: 原告

Example sentences

判決は被告に有利だった。
hanketsu ha hikoku ni yuuri daxtsu ta 。
The decision was in favor of the defendant.
陪審員たちは被告の年齢を考慮するよう求められた。
baishin in tachi ha hikoku no nenrei wo kouryo suru you motome rare ta 。
The jury were asked to allow for the age of the accused.
証拠不充分のため被告は釈放された。
shouko fu juubun no tame hikoku ha shakuhou sa re ta 。
In the absence of firm evidence the prisoner was set free.
裁判長は被告に大いに同情していた。
saiban chou ha hikoku ni ooini doujou shi te i ta 。
The presiding judge was touched by pity for the accused.
裁判長は被告に死刑の判決を言い渡した。
saiban chou ha hikoku ni shikei no hanketsu wo iiwatashi ta 。
The presiding judge sentenced the defendant to death.
検察側は被告が子供を誘拐したと激しく非難した。
kensatsu gawa ha hikoku ga kodomo wo yuukai shi ta to hageshiku hinan shi ta 。
The prosecution condemned the defendant for kidnapping a child.
